Spanish wines are wines produced in Spain. Located on the Iberian Peninsula, Spain has over 2.9 million acres (over 1.17 million hectares) planted—making it the most widely planted wine-producing nation but it is the third largest producer of wine in the world, the largest being Italy followed by France. This is due, in part, to the very low yields and wide spacing of the old vines planted on the dry, infertile soil found in many Spanish wine regions. The country is ninth in worldwide consumptions with Spaniards drinking, on average, 21.6 litres (5.706 US gal) per person a year. The country has an abundance of native grape varieties, with over 400 varieties planted throughout Spain though 80 percent of the country’s wine production is from only 20 grapes.

Tio Pepe Sherry Fino 15% 1L
Tío Pepe, produced by González Byass in Jerez de la Frontera (Cádiz), is one of the most famous and acclaimed sherries in the world.
This 100 percent sherry is made from Palomino grapes planted at a 600 acre estate on the outskirts Jerez, in the “Jerez Superior” area.
The harvest is carried out manually and the grapes are transported in 15-kg boxes to prevent them from breaking and beginning fermentation prematurely.
The grapes are gently crushed to obtain the first pressing. Fermentation takes place in stainless steel tanks at a controlled temperature. The must obtains 12-13% alcohol content, and will later be used as a “vino fino” (refined wine) or Oloroso sherry.
Wine that is selected to become part of the “criadera” of Tío Pepe is fortified with wine alcohol up to 15% ABV, becoming a “Sobretabla Fino” that will age one more year in American oak casks before becoming part of the “Criaderas y Solera” range, a denomination it will keep for at least five years.
